My grandmother is already receiving a pension from the Railways (central.gov) due to the service of my grandfather. My uncle (son of my grandmother), who worked for the geological department (State.gov), passed away. Is she eligible for my uncle's pension? Can a person receive two pensions, one from the central government and another from the state government?
